Cryptocurrency Taxes in Belgium

Belgian law distinguishes between normal management of personal assets and speculative trading. Profits from crypto exchange within normal management are generally not taxed. Speculative transactions may be subject to miscellaneous income tax. Specific conditions depend on circumstances, for large operations, consulting a tax specialist is recommended.
